Background information
Used for in vitro quantitative test of Feline Serum Amyloid A (fSAA) concentration in whole blood, serum or plasma. Clinically, it is mainly used for the auxiliary diagnosis and treatment effect evaluation of feline inflammatory diseases.
Test time: 3min
Test samples: whole blood, serum or plasma
Detection principle:This test employs a quantitative double antibody sandwich fluorescence immunoassay technique. Take the sample and add it into the sample dilution, mix it, then drop the mixed sample into the well of the test card, The fSAA in the sample reacts with a fluorescently labeled antibody coated on the glass fiber to
form a complex substance. Under chromatography, the complex substance and
unreacted fluorescently labeled antibody diffuse forward along the nitrocellulose
membrane, and the complex substance is captured by the corresponding antigen fixed on the nitrocellulose membrane detection line. The more analytes in this test, the more complexes formed by reaction with fluorescently labeled antibodies, and the more fluorescently labeled antibodies accumulate on the detection line. The fSAA concentration is expressed mg/L as the unit.
